About the course
Rock Springs Ridge Golf Club feature a championship 18-hole course designed by the architectural team of Clifton, Ezell & Clifton. The course opened as a 9-hole facility in 1997 and a second nine was added in 2001. Located a shor drive northwest of Orlando, Rock Springs Ridge has rolling, tree lined fairways and plays through some noticeable elevation changes. The greens are large and challenging to putt. Water comes into play on a few holes, and there are plenty of strategically placed bunkers to accommodate risk/reward play. The course measures from 4,962 to 7,135-yards and there are four sets of tees to accommodate all skill levels. For additional information call the pro shop at (407) 814-7474.
